- FOA Quantity: DE-FOA-0003329
- Funding Quantity: $33 million
- Deadline for Idea Papers: Aug. 21, 2024, at 5 pm ET
Matters Embrace Good Manufacturing for a Round Economic system, Sustainable Transportation, Excessive-Efficiency Supplies, and Home Mining
The U.S. Division of Vitality’s (DOE) Advanced Materials and Manufacturing Technologies Office (AMMTO) launched a $33 million funding alternative to speed up the development of good manufacturing applied sciences and processes essential to develop and deploy the progressive applied sciences and supplies wanted for the nation’s clear vitality transition. Good manufacturing is the usage of superior applied sciences and processes—together with digitalization and synthetic intelligence—to enhance the technical efficiency, productiveness, high quality assurance, and safety of the manufacturing sector.
“Smart manufacturing solutions are critical to domestically manufacture next generation clean energy technologies more economically, more efficiently, and at the higher quality and scale we need to be globally competitive,” stated AMMTO Director Christopher Saldaña. “This funding opportunity offers developers a chance to have an incredible impact on the future trajectory of our nation’s manufacturing sector and elevate our nation’s most promising technological advancements in the process.”
Recipients of funding from this chance will assist analysis to develop good manufacturing applied sciences that enhance the effectivity and economics of round provide chains; advance sustainable transportation manufacturing; speed up the event of high-performance supplies for the clear vitality transition; and create extra sustainable, secure, and aggressive mining in the US.
Matter 1: Good Manufacturing for a Round Economic system
This subject focuses on good manufacturing options that enhance the viability of round provide chains (Re-X pathways), akin to recycling, repairing, remanufacturing, and reuse, by enhancing their effectivity and economics. This contains:
- Space of Curiosity 1: Good Manufacturing Applied sciences for Improved Sorting and Characterization. Enhancing the flexibility to establish, kind, and characterize supplies to facilitate restoration and recycling of those supplies into new merchandise.
- Space of Curiosity 2: Interoperable and Open Provide Chains for Expanded Re-X. Fostering extra interoperable and open provide chains to assist restore or remanufacturing merchandise not initially designed for Re-X (reuse, restore, refurbish, remanufacture, or repurpose).
- Space of Curiosity 3. Improved Knowledge Transparency for Correct Lifecycle Assessments. Enhancing the supply and transparency of information important to bolstering market acceptance of secondary supplies.
Matter 2: Good Manufacturing of Tooling and Tools for Sustainable Transportation
This subject focuses on good manufacturing applied sciences that make tooling and tools for sustainable autos quicker and extra economically, whereas decreasing element defects and enabling new functionalities. Within the context of this FOA, sustainable transportation refers to electrical autos (based mostly on both batteries or gas cells throughout all car sorts from cars to fleets to all truck courses). This contains:
- Space of Curiosity 1: Automation. Integrating {hardware} and software program methods into manufacturing tooling and tools to enhance element productiveness.
- Space of Curiosity 2: Manufacturing Asset Administration for Enhancing System Efficiency. Enhancing the efficiency (value, high quality, and throughput) of the tooling and tools, industrial controls, and automation community.
Matter 3: Good Manufacturing for Excessive-Efficiency Supplies
This subject focuses on growing, validating, and prototyping new high-performance supplies (HPMs) and their manufacturing processes. Of specific curiosity are manufacturing processes and fabrication strategies for HPMs for the clear vitality transition, akin to high-conductivity supplies and supplies for harsh service situations. This contains:
- Space of Curiosity 1: Excessive-Efficiency Supplies and Course of Discovery. Growing excessive throughput methods for conductivity-enhanced and harsh atmosphere supplies synthesis/testing, used along side computational instruments.
- Space of Curiosity 2: Excessive-Efficiency Supplies Manufacturing, Meeting and Scaleup. Creating aggressive manufacturing and meeting approaches that make the most of a wide range of good manufacturing instruments in supplies manufacturing.
Matter 4: Good Applied sciences for Sustainable and Aggressive U.S. Mining
This subject focuses on growing novel good manufacturing applied sciences that may be utilized to create extra sustainable, secure, and aggressive mining in the US. Fostering developments in mining will allow a extra resilient, numerous, and safe home provide of important minerals and supplies. This contains:
- Space of Curiosity 1: Sustainable and Aggressive Home Mining. Establishing good manufacturing applied sciences akin to sensors, controls, and automation that may present well being, security, environmental, and financial advantages to mining operations.
- Space of Curiosity 2: Sensing, Analytics, and Knowledge-Pushed Choice Making in Mining. Advancing new and transformative mining applied sciences that supply important advantages over the present commercially accessible state-of-the-art analytical devices and sensors and are extra accessible and reasonably priced.
